ORLANDO, Fla. - (01/24/06) -- CFE FCU said Monday it hasintegrated its credit management system with RouteOne LLC. The $1billion credit union integrated RouteOne with Teres Solutions' SAILIndirect software, which will allow it to electronically tap intothe RouteOne network to receive and manage loan applications.RouteOne is a single point of access for dealer credit applicationswhich is used by some of the largest auto lenders, allowing dealersto exchange credit applications and credit decisions in real time.RouteOne is owned by DaimlerChrysler Services, Ford Motor Credit,GMAC and Toyota Financial Services.
